Roundtable “How Gas technologies and infrastructure are providing solutions to our EU energy and climate challenges”, Brussels

GIE, GERG and a third GasNaturally partner MARCOGAZ, are organising a roundtable on how the gas industry is facing EU energy and climate challenges that take place on 5 March at the European Parliament.

The event will be Hosted by MEPs Maria Da Graça Carvalho (EPP) and António Fernando Correia De Campos (S&D). Representatives of the European Commission, the Permanent Representation of Ireland and the gas industry will also attend the event.

GERG was founded in 1961 to strengthen the gas industry within the European Community and it achieves this by promoting research and technological innovation in all aspects of the gas chain.

Gas Infrastructure Europe (GIE) is an association representing the sole interest of the infrastructure industry in the natural gas business such as Transmission System Operators, Storage System Operators and LNG Terminal Operators. GIE has currently 66 members in 26 European countries.
